P6项目管理软件怎么创建副本:详细操作步骤与最佳实践指南
在企业级项目管理中,Oracle Primavera P6 是广泛使用的专业工具。它支持复杂项目的进度计划、资源分配、成本控制和绩效分析。然而,当需要对现有项目进行测试、培训或版本迭代时,直接修改原始项目可能导致数据风险。因此,学会如何正确地在 P6 中创建项目副本(Project Copy)是每个项目经理和系统管理员的核心技能之一。
为什么需要创建项目副本?
创建项目副本有多种实用场景:
- 测试新计划变更:在不影响正式项目的情况下模拟调整工期、资源或预算。
- 培训用途:为新员工提供一个真实但可安全操作的项目环境。
- 历史归档:保留已完成项目的结构用于审计或复用模板。
- 多版本对比:比如“项目A_v1”和“项目A_v2”,便于评估不同策略的效果。
- 灾难恢复准备:作为备份机制,避免因误删或系统故障导致项目丢失。
P6项目管理软件怎么创建副本?基础流程详解
以下是使用 Oracle Primavera P6 Professional 或 Web 客户端执行项目复制的标准步骤:
步骤一:登录并导航到目标项目
首先确保你拥有足够的权限(通常为“Project Manager”或“Admin”角色)。进入 P6 后,在左侧导航栏选择 Projects 模块,找到你要复制的项目名称,点击进入详情页。
步骤二:访问“复制项目”功能
在项目详情页面顶部菜单栏,点击 Actions 下拉按钮,选择 Copy Project。或者,在项目列表视图中右键点击该项目,选择“Copy”选项。
步骤三:配置复制参数
弹出的复制对话框包含多个关键设置项:
- 新项目名称:建议使用清晰标识符,如“OriginalName_Copy_YYYYMMDD”。
- 描述信息:填写简要说明,例如“用于测试新版资源调度方案”。
- 是否复制基线:若希望保留原项目的基线状态,请勾选此项;否则,新项目将无基线,适合从零开始规划。
- 是否复制日历:包括工作日历、节假日等,适用于跨地区项目迁移。
- 是否复制任务关联关系:保持原有逻辑链路,便于验证变更影响。
- 是否复制资源分配:决定是否继承所有任务的资源分配情况。
- 是否复制进度更新:如果复制的是当前已执行的项目,此选项可保留进度记录。
- 是否复制文档附件:包括 PDF、Excel 文件等,增强知识传承能力。
步骤四:执行复制并监控进度
确认所有选项后,点击“OK”启动复制进程。系统会显示进度条,耗时取决于项目规模(任务数量、资源数、附件大小等)。对于大型项目(>10万任务),可能需要几分钟甚至更长时间。
步骤五:验证副本完整性
复制完成后,进入新项目查看其结构是否完整,包括:
• 任务列表、层级关系、逻辑连接
• 资源分配明细及可用性
• 基线状态(如有)
• 文档库内容
• 自定义字段和属性
高级技巧:批量复制与脚本自动化
对于频繁复制的需求(如每月生成项目模板),可以借助 P6 的 API 或命令行工具实现自动化:
使用 P6 Command Line Interface (CLI)
通过 CLI 工具 `p6copy` 可以编写脚本批量处理多个项目复制任务,尤其适用于企业级部署。示例命令:
p6copy -project OriginalProjectName -newProject NewProjectName -copyBaseline true -copyResources true
集成于 DevOps 流程
结合 Jenkins、GitLab CI 等持续集成平台,可在代码提交后自动触发项目副本创建,确保每次迭代都有独立测试环境。
常见问题与解决方案
问题1:复制失败提示“权限不足”
原因:当前用户未被授予“Create Project”权限。
解决方法:联系系统管理员,在用户权限组中添加相应权限,或临时切换至具备权限的账户操作。
问题2:复制后的项目无法打开或报错
原因:可能是数据库锁冲突、网络中断或文件损坏。
解决方法:重启 P6 应用服务,重新尝试复制;必要时联系 Oracle 支持团队排查数据库异常。
问题3:复制速度慢且卡顿
原因:项目过大(>50万个任务)、服务器性能不足或并发请求过多。
解决方法:优化项目结构(拆分大项目)、升级硬件配置、错峰操作。
最佳实践建议
- 命名规范统一:建立公司内部命名规则,如“项目名_副本类型_日期”,提升可追溯性。
- 定期清理无效副本:避免占用数据库空间,建议每月审查并删除过期副本。
- 使用项目模板而非副本:对于标准化流程,优先考虑创建模板而非每次都复制,提高效率。
- 做好版本控制意识:每次复制都应记录变更目的,方便后续回溯。
- 培训团队掌握技能:组织内部培训,让成员熟悉复制流程,减少依赖管理员。
结语
掌握 P6 项目管理软件怎么创建副本不仅是一项技术技能,更是项目治理的重要组成部分。它能有效降低风险、提升效率,并为企业构建稳健的项目管理体系打下坚实基础。无论是日常运维还是战略部署,熟练运用这一功能都将显著增强你的项目执行力和灵活性。





